CVE-2020-2173
Last modified
CVE-2020-2173 is a medium-severity vulnerability rated 5.4/10 on the CVSS scale. Jenkins Gatling Plugin 1.2.7 and earlier prevents Content-Security-Policy headers from being set for Gatling reports served by the plugin, resulting in an XSS vulnerability exploitable by users able to change report content.. EPSS estimates a 0.70%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
